Junior/Mid-Level Hardware Technician

Join us and make a difference in National Security!

Job Summary

The selected candidate will be responsible for supporting the physical integrations (rack, stack, cabling), deployment and sustainment of development and operational systems. She/he will research and evaluate processes and utilize best practices to create and modify Deployment Packages (Microsoft Excel), Rack Elevations (Microsoft Excel), Master Cable Lists (Microsoft Excel), and Wiring Diagrams (Visio). She/he will perform short duration travel to support deployments and must be available to provide after‑hours surge support when needed to meet customer requirements.

Primary

Responsibilities
  • Assemble devices and equipment and perform initial physical integrations of multi‑rack systems.
  • Support deployments of multi‑rack systems both CONUS and OCONUS.
  • Provide support for a lab consisting of ~100 racks to include physical integrations, power, space, and cooling estimates, power testing, and monitoring and troubleshooting of hardware.
  • Develop installation plans and coordinate redesign efforts with system administration and system engineering teams.
  • Establish and conduct test cases and coordinate with System and Network Engineers in troubleshooting suspected failed components, including hard drives, memory, batteries, cables, motherboards, and processors.
  • Operate electronics test equipment to include fiber and copper test sets, OTDRs, multi‑meters, etc.
  • Plan and implement data center enhancements and undertake lab and deployment‑related special project work.
